Projekt

Obecné

Profil

Úkol #8379

otevřený

Zajistit vznik svobodné elektronické platformy pro účinné fungování Pirátské strany (nextcloud)

Přidáno uživatelem Tomáš Vymazal před více než 6 roky(ů). Aktualizováno před více než 5 roky(ů).

Stav:
V řešení (diskutuje se)
Priorita:
Normální
Přiřazeno:
Cílová verze:
-
Začátek:
05.11.2017
Uzavřít do:
12.11.2017 (více než 6 roky(ů) pozdě)
% Hotovo:

0%

Odhadovaná doba:
(Celkem: 11.00hod)
Typ práce:
Vedení projektů
Organizační struktura:
Ano
Smlouva:
Popis stavu a další krok:

Popis

Potřebujeme se konečně zbavit znouzectnostného využívání služeb firem Facebook, Google, Microsoft a případných dalších nadnárodních korporací, které jsme za ty roky fungování Pirátské strany v rozporu s našimi ideály využívali a kterým jsme tak v minulosti dali nad Pirátskou stranou obrovskou moc. Jestli proti nám tyto společnosti naše data nezneužily v minulosti, můžeme to brát jako pozitivní skutečnost. Bylo by ale velmi pošetilé se na tomto základě domnívat, že nás nezradí ani v okamžicích, kdy budeme mluvit do významných státních záležitostí, a nadále zůstávat mezi aktivními uživateli jejich služeb.

Zadání je široké, ale v celku jasné. Chceme webové řešení, které umožňuje kooperativní tvorbu dokumentů, dělbu úkolů a související zodpovědnosti, pokročilé sdílení souborů, tvorbu a sdílení kalendářů a databází kontaktů, zálohování osobních dat uživatelů, publikování stanovisek na sociálních sítích a webech z jednoho místa, šifrované chatování a videohovory pro instantní komunikaci a skupinovou komunikaci, šifrované i nezabezpečené emailování z Pirátského mailhostingu, nikoliv jen domény, dohledatelné hlasování, podávání a automatickou validaci žádostí o proplacení (z hlediska připustnosti), správu stranického účetnictví, rychlou a přehlednou evidenci členů a dobrovolníků, péči o nováčky v naší komunitě, retenci odpadávajících členů, zpracování a archivaci tisků na zasedání různých orgánů státní moci, stravitelnou vnitrostranickou diskuzi, tvorbu sdílené báze vědomostí, přípravu propagačních materiálů, kampaní a výstupů, prohloubení stranické demokracie navzdory značnému nárůstu členů, transparentní úkolování a odměňování zaměstnanců strany, přívětivou uživatelskou podporu přímo v místě vzniku problémů bez ticketů a jiných zdržení, korespondující sadu doporučených mobilních aplikací pro různé mobilní platformy, to všechno se single-sign-on a dvoufázovou autentizací napříč kontaktem se stranou a jejími systémy.

Chceme, aby se mohli členové strany za naše systémy přestat stydět, a naopak se na ně mohli spolehnout. Být Pirátem je přece prestižní záležitost, a podle toho by měl vypadat i servis, který svým členům strana poskytuje. Máme ve svých řadách hned několik systémových IT odborníků, tak jim dejme prostor pomoci nám všem.

Tolik k motivaci a popisu cílového stavu. Zbývá jen shrnout, jak toho chci (obklopen odborníky) dosáhnout. Už dnes máme několik více či méně kvalitních technických systémů, z nichž je na místě zachovat vše, co funguje. Máme Redmine, který by sice snesl několik nových pluginu pro rozšíření funkcionality, ale obecně funguje. Máme účetnictví, k jehož funkčnosti a správnosti dopomůžeme především tím, že uděláme pořádek v alokaci stranických prostředků v jednotlivých rozpočtech a následném podávání žádostí o proplacení. Je nezbytné používat systém, který bude podstatně rychlejší než současná dokuwiki a zároveň bude kontrolovat prezenci základních poznávacích znaků oprávněné a správně podané žádosti o proplacení. Máme funkční hlasovací systém Helios, který jsme si ovšem nezvykli používat, ačkoliv narozdíl od fóra splňuje všechny požadavky, které na hlasovací systém máme. Máme stranické fórum, které teoreticky může sloužit k vnitrostranické diskusi (leč nepřehledné), ale rozhodně není vhodným nástrojem na příjemnou práci v kolektivu.

Nejvetší změny nás pak čekají především v oblastech, kde se dosud Pirátská strana spoléhala na řešení poskytovaná zmíněnými nadnárodními korporacemi. Email, kalendáře, kontakty, poznámky, sdílení souborů, kooperativní tvorba dokumentů, inteligentní formuláře, chat, volání, videohovory, skupinové informování o chystaných událostech a obecná kooperace v rámci pracovních skupin, zálohování citlivých dat, správa osobních sad přístupových údajů a například i blogy. To všechno jsme dosud sháněli, kde se dalo, ale nikdy jsme to neměli na jedné hromadě a plně funkční. Jakmile bude spuštěn testovací provoz cloudového řešení NextCloud, budete si moci ověřit, že za nás komunita kolem tohoto svobodného software udělala velkou spoustu práce a my už se musíme jen domluvit, jak přesně si tento systém přizpůsobíme. V další fázi musí dojit k integraci NextCloudu s těmi stranickými systémy, které se rozhodneme zachovat. To bude pravděpodobně nejtěžší částí celého projektu, protože budeme narážet na funkční, kosmetické a byrokratické překážky. Jakmile se podaři tuto strastiplnou fázi překonat, bude nás už čekat jen integrace s nějakým okleštěným ERP systémem, který nám umožní se patřičně věnovat našim ždrojům (dobrovolníkům Pirátům) a na základě reálné statistiky doladit naše workflow, abychom přestali plýtvat časem a talentem.

Toto je rodičovský úkol pro všechny úkoly směřující k vývoji lepšího technického zázemí než teď máme. Neváhejte komentářovou sekci využít pro sdělování zpětné vazby a vašich nápadů -- nemám s tvorbou takovéhoto řešení žádné zkušenosti, takže vstupy velice uvítám.


Dílčí úkoly 5 (0 otevřených5 uzavřených)

Úkol #8367: Nasazení KVM, debianu a dockeru na VPSDokončen05.11.201709.11.2017

Akce
Úkol #8380: Navrhnout koncepci využití IPFS nebo PGP pro ukládání a sdílení dokumentůDokončen06.11.201709.11.2017

Akce
Úkol #8381: Rozchodit na serveru minimální verzi NextCloudu a nastudovat z dokumentace a provozu jeho ovládání a možnosti konfiguraceDokončen06.11.201709.11.2017

Akce
Úkol #8382: Navrhnout seznam konfiguračních změn ve stranickém RedmineDokončen06.11.201709.11.2017

Akce
Úkol #8383: Analyzovat možnosti nahrazení MySQL v Byrocracy pluginu DokuWiki jiným databázovým prostředím Dokončen06.11.201712.11.2017

Akce

Související úkoly

související s Technický odbor - Dlouhodobý úkol #8616: NextCloudDokončen

Akce

Aktualizováno uživatelem Tomáš Vymazal před více než 6 roky(ů)

  • Typ práce změněn z Plánování na Vedení projektů

Aktualizováno uživatelem Martin Rejman před více než 6 roky(ů)

Aktualizováno uživatelem Jakub Michálek před více než 6 roky(ů)

  • Kategorie smazán (Technické systémy)
  • Projekt změněn z Sněmovna 2017-2021 na Vedení poslaneckého klubu

Aktualizováno uživatelem Jakub Michálek před více než 5 roky(ů)

  • translation missing: cs.field_checklist změněn z [] na [{"id":12,"is_done":false,"subject":"zkontrolovat, že existují všechny skupiny resortních týmů, asistentů a vedení klubu v Nextcloud","position":1,"issue_id":8379,"created_at":"2018-12-04T17:30:16.256Z","updated_at":"2018-12-04T17:30:16.256Z"},{"id":13,"is_done":false,"subject":"zkontrolovat, že týmy mají svoje složky","position":8,"issue_id":8379,"created_at":"2018-12-04T17:30:16.258Z","updated_at":"2018-12-04T17:30:16.258Z"},{"id":14,"is_done":false,"subject":"vymyslet metodiku na oběh dokumentů (např. na příkladu novely zákona připravované dle RFC)","position":9,"issue_id":8379,"created_at":"2018-12-04T17:30:16.260Z","updated_at":"2018-12-04T17:30:16.260Z"}]
  • % Hotovo nastaven na 0
  • Začátek nastaven na 05.11.2017
  • Uzavřít do nastaven na 12.11.2017
  • Předmět změněn z Zajistit vznik svobodné elektronické platformy pro účinné fungování Pirátské strany na Zajistit vznik svobodné elektronické platformy pro účinné fungování Pirátské strany (nextcloud)
  • Fronta změněn z Dlouhodobý úkol na Úkol
  • Tags nastaven na from:ppk

Tomáše jsem požádal, aby ve spolupráci s Martinem Rejmanem dokončil implementaci Nextcloud.

Také k dispozici: Atom PDF